Description
Overview
McGuireWoods has an opportunity for a detail-oriented analyst to join its Finance team as a Senior Financial Analyst in our Richmond office. This role will support multiple legal departments by developing comprehensive financial reporting and analytical frameworks to drive strategic decision-making across the firm. The Senior Financial Analyst serves as the primary financial resource to provide interpretive guidance on key metrics, variance analyses, and profitability insights to Department Chairs, partners, and lawyers, while collaborating across departmental and geographic lines to deliver client/matter pricing models, engagement analyses, and revenue optimization presentations that support the firm's growth objectives.
McGuireWoods, one of the world’s leading law firms, has provided legal solutions to corporate, individual and nonprofit clients since 1834. Responsibilities
Acts as the primary source of consultative financial analyses for the Department Chairs. Provide comprehensive analysis with identification of trends, root causes, linkage to broader business context and recommendations for possible course corrections. Prepare Department Chairs to present their department’s quarterly financial performance to senior firm management; the Senior Financial Analyst participates in the quarterly financial performance meetings.
Prepare client/matter pricing analyses. This includes consulting with lawyers on ways to improve the financial performance of current and proposed arrangements. Help develop Alternative Fee Arrangements (AFAs) and monitor progress against project budgets and profitability targets.
Perform lateral hiring analyses for new lawyers or groups that join the firm. This includes providing advice on determining standard billing rates, billable hours targets and compensation and bonus structures.
Help review the monthly/quarterly/annual reports prepared by Associate Financial Analysts. Will also distribute reports to the intended recipients once finalized.
Prepare periodic analyses and written summaries of multiple key firm clients’ financial performance. The analyses will be shared with responsible partners, Department Chairs and senior firm management.
Calculate annual bonuses for lawyers with incentive bonus agreements and monitor the agreements for any other mid-year financial calculations.
Assist with firm annual budgeting as needed, including calculating estimated incentive bonuses.
Work with all administrative departments within the firm to ensure our lawyer and firm management needs are met.
Simultaneously work on multiple assignments and projects.
Maintain timely and open communication of assignments with the Manager, Financial Analysis.
